2020年5月19日
摘要: 内存对齐主要遵循下面三个原则: 结构体变量的起始地址能够被其最宽的成员大小整除 结构体每个成员相对于起始地址的偏移能够被其自身大小整除,如果不能则在前一个成员后面补充字节 结构体总体大小能够被最宽的成员的大小整除,如不能则在后面补充字 上代码 struct A { a: u8, b: u32, c: 阅读全文
posted @ 2020-05-19 10:26 chen8840 阅读(1460) 评论(0) 推荐(0) 编辑